Ist Commonismus Kommunismus?
Commonsbasierte Peer-Produktion und der kommunistische Anspruch

During the last decades, a new mode of production has emerged, for which names such as "commons-based peer production," "cornmonism," and "peer economi' have been proposed, This article explores the main characteristics of this mode of prodnction and discusses the relationship between commonism and communism: if communism is "the real movement which abolishes the present state of things", can commonism become the mode of production which allows this movement to realize this purpose?
